Effect of tea polyphenols on expression of TGF-β_1 in the kidney of streptozocin-induced diabetic nephropathy rats

Objective:To explore the mechanism of action of tea polyphenols(TPs) in the prevention and treatment of early diabetic nephropathy.Methods:Setting up the model of diabetic nephropathy(DN)in rats and then dividing them into five groups:(1)control with resection of one kidney;(2)DN control;(3)DN with treatment of TPs;(4)DN with synchronous treatment of TPs;(5)DN with deferred treatment of TPs.After the model established,their blood sugar and urinary protein in 24 hours were detected at the time point of 0,2 and 4 weeks.Protein and mRNA of TGF -β 1 in their renal tissues were also studied.Results:TPs treatment decreased urinary protein,restrained the up-regulation of TGF-β 1 in renal tissue and protected against early diabetic glomerular injury in DN rats.Preventive treatment of TPs on DN rats shows the best effects.Conclusion:TPs inhibited TGF-β 1 protein and mRNA over-expression in renal cortex of diabetic rats,suggesting that TPs might play a beneficial role in experimental diabetic nephropathy.Its mechanism may be partly by inhibiting TGF-β 1 protein and mRNA over-expression in kidney.
